What reviewers say

Visitors frequently praise the Inlet View Tower for its delicious, home-cooked food and exceptionally friendly, welcoming service, with many feeling like valued friends. However, some guests report significant issues with the facility, including a lack of hot water, cleanliness concerns like roaches and stained items, and outdated or poorly maintained rooms.

Very centrally located . No frills apartment housing near everything in Anchorage . Service can be slow but I lucked out with Jimmy that fixed our fobs, and another employee that came to help fix our heaters . Plus he lent us a space heater ! Both of these employees were exemplary! Kudos to both of them . Very grateful for their excellent service . .Building was built between 1950’s- 60’s so expect bad insulation from the cold , defective or broken heaters , and only 1 elevator available since the other one has electrical wiring problems that are hard to fix due to a 1960’s electrical installation. Getting a good apartment with everything working can be a luck of the draw! But you cannot beat the price , that is for sure .
